#56ce68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#56ce68 is composed of 33.7% red, 80.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 49.5%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 129 degrees, a saturation of 55% and a lightness of 57.3%. #56ce68 color hex could be obtained by blending #acffd0 with #009d00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#56ce68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040d05 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#56ce68

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919391 is the less saturated color, while #2cf84b is the most saturated one.
